DEPARTMENT OF LABOR

Employment and Training Administration

TA-W-50,422

ALTX, INC.
WATERVALIET, NEW YORK

Certification Regarding Eligibility
To Apply for Worker Adjustment Assistance


In accordance with Section 223 of the Trade Act of 1974 (19
USC 2273), as amended, the Department of Labor herein presents
the results of its investigation regarding certification of
eligibility to apply for worker adjustment assistance.
In order to make an affirmative determination and issue a
certification of eligibility to apply for Trade Adjustment
Assistance, the group eligibility requirements in either
paragraph (a)(2)(A) or (a)(2)(B) of Section 222 of the Trade Act
must be met. It is determined in this case that the
requirements of (a)(2)(A) of Section 222 have been met.
The investigation was initiated on January 2, 2003 in
response to a petition filed by United Steelworkers of America;
Local 4867 on behalf of the workers at ALTX, Inc., Watervaliet,
New York. The workers produce stainless steel shapes and pipes.
The workers are not separately identifiable by product line.
The investigation revealed that sales, production, and
employment at the subject firm showed an absolute decline in
2002 when compared to 2001.
The Department of Labor surveyed the subject firm's major
customers regarding their purchases of stainless steel shapes
and pipes in 2001 and 2002. The survey revealed during the
relevant time period customers increased import purchases of
stainless steel shapes and pipes while reducing purchases from
the subject firm.



Conclusion
After careful review of the facts obtained in the
investigation, I conclude that increases of imports of articles
like or directly competitive with those produced at ALTX, Inc.,
Watervaliet, New York contributed importantly to the decline in
sales or production and to the total or partial separation of
workers of that firm. In accordance with the provisions of the
Act, I make the following certification:
"All workers of the ALTX, Inc., Watervaliet, New York who
became totally or partially separated from employment on or
after December 30, 2001, through two years from the date of
certification are eligible to apply for adjustment
assistance under Section 223 of the Trade Act of 1974."
